Explanation:
The force that keeps the Earth in circular motion around the Sun is the gravitational force between the Earth and the Sun, whose magnitude is given by:
where
is the gravitational constant
m is the mass of the Earth
M is the mass of the Sun
r is the distance between them
From the equation, we observe that this force depends only on three factors:
- the mass of the Earth
- the mass of the Sun
- their separation
If the Sun is replaced by a black hole of the same mass, none of these factors would change (the central mass M would remain the same), therefore the gravitational force F would not change, and therefore the orbit of the Earth would not change.

In the process of spinning ,fibres from a mass of cotton are drawn out and twisted. This brings the tiny fibres together to form long and twisted threads called yarn. ... Spinning of yarn on a large scale is done by using spinning machines in mills or factories.
